There are many reasons for threatened abortion. For example, in our daily life, if we want to treat threatened abortion as soon as possible, we must pay attention to a reasonable diet. Pregnant women still need to pay attention to choosing foods that contain various vitamins or trace elements, including some easily digestible foods, such as many fruits, beans, vegetables, eggs, meat, etc.

Keep a good mood: Studies have shown that some spontaneous abortions are caused by central nervous system excitement in pregnant women. Regular prenatal check-ups: Pregnant women should start regular prenatal check-ups in the second trimester to promptly detect and deal with abnormalities in pregnancy and ensure the healthy development of the fetus. Life rules: A peaceful daily life is the best. Don’t be too lazy (such as sleeping too much), nor be too hard-working (such as lifting heavy objects or climbing high places or taking dangerous steps).

Be careful about sexual intercourse: Pregnant women with a history of spontaneous abortion should avoid sexual intercourse within 3 months of pregnancy and after 7 months. Those with habitual abortion should strictly prohibit sexual intercourse during this period. People with tuberculosis, anemia, pneumonia, thyroid and other diseases, as well as women with poor physical constitution, are prone to fetal leakage and fetal movement disorder. Therefore, they should actively treat the primary disease before pregnancy, and consider pregnancy and childbirth after recovery.
